本文在网络延迟、带宽需求与VPS规格层面对用于< b>PS4 多人联机的< b>新加坡VPS做了实测和实践建议,并给出可行的端口映射与穿透方案(如VPN、反向隧道、iptables/ socat 转发),同时提示选择节点、网络运营商对等、DDoS与安全配置的注意点,便于在不同网络环境下实现稳定联机。
要保证多人联机体验,最关键是低延迟与稳定带宽。作为经验值,单人到新加坡机房的往返时延(RTT)低于60ms通常可接受,邻近东南亚玩家应力求<50ms以下;带宽方面,如果只是做匹配/转发,单会话上下行可按3–10Mbps估算;若在VPS上托管多人服务器(或作为中继),建议至少100Mbps出口带宽且无流量突发限制。
根据用途不同建议不同配置:做轻量中继/VPN(仅做流量转发或WireGuard):1–2核CPU、1–2GB内存、100Mbps带宽即可;若要托管多人游戏服务器或大量并发(如十几人以上或需要解包/应用层处理):2–4核CPU、4GB及以上内存、独享带宽200Mbps+。此外优先选择有IPv4/IPv6、DDoS防护与良好网络对等(Peering)的供应商。
选择机房时看三个要点:①机房到目标玩家ISP的对等关系(影响抖动与丢包);②机房的出口带宽与是否有专门的游戏网络优化;③是否提供高速IPv4并允许UDP/TCP端口转发。通常新加坡机房对东南亚和南中国沿海地区延迟最低,但具体应通过Ping/Traceroute测试目标ISP的实际RTT与跳数。
家庭路由器通常把< b>PS4置于私网,若没有控制路由器无法直接把VPS的公网端口映射到PS4的内网IP。使用VPN(如WireGuard)可以让PS4或家中路由器成为VPS网络的一员,从而实现端口直达;反向隧道(frp、ssh -R)适合在不能改路由器时把内网服务暴露到VPS。直接在VPS上用iptables对公网端口做DNAT到家庭IP不可行(因家庭IP不是VPS内网的一部分),因此VPN/反向隧道是更稳妥的方式。
给出常见可行方案与要点:1) WireGuard VPN:在VPS装WireGuard,家用路由安装客户端或在运行树莓派/软路由上接入,配置允许转发并在VPS上开启IP转发与NAT(sysctl net.ipv4.ip_forward=1,i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E),此法支持UDP/TCP并减少NAT问题。2) 反向TCP隧道(frp或ssh -R):若仅需转发少量端口可用frp做TCP/UDP反向代理,配置简单且不需改路由器。3) socat/iptables(在控制端局域网网关可用):在网关上做端口转发到PS4的局域网IP,示例(VPS端为目标):若使用VPN,直接在VPS建立DNAT:iptables -t nat -A PREROUTING -p udp --dport 3478 -j DNAT --to-destination 10.0.0.2:3478,并确保FORWARD策略允许。4) UPnP:如果路由器支持并可受控,允许PS4启用UPnP自动映射端口。注意UDP端口(PSN常用3478-3479)与TCP端口(80/443/1935/3478-3480)均可能需要开放,视游戏而定。
开放端口或创建VPN时要注意:只开放必要端口并限制来源IP(iptables -A INPUT -p tcp --dport 1935 -s 指定IP -j ACCEPT);对SSH启用密钥认证并更改默认端口;在VPS上启用基础防火墙(UFW/nftables)和Fail2ban;若流量敏感,选带DDoS防护的机房或使用云厂商防护;为UDP中继注意丢包/抖动,必要时在VPS上增加队列/流控或选择更大带宽套餐。
成本取决于带宽与规格:轻量级VPN中继月费可在5–15美元左右(1–2核、100Mbps共享);高性能专线或独享带宽200Mbps+价格显著上升,可能数十至上百美元/月。选择前确认供应商允许用于游戏流量(有些云商禁用P2P或游戏用途),并注意地域法规与隐私政策以确保合规。
